Tuesday, October 9, 2012

This Is More or Less How I Dance [DTM Video 004]

Here's a clip that may well be the most disturbing 30 seconds of your day.

I think it's awesome when it's completely out of context. If you're curious, check out Guinea Pig 4 (or 6, depending on who you ask): Devil Woman Doctor.

No comments:

Post a Comment